The market size value per capita for women's and girls' bathrobes and dressing gowns made of materials other than synthetic fibers and cotton in Italy remains stable with a forecasted value of $0.19 USD from 2024 to 2028. Compared to 2023, where it stood at $0.19 USD, there is an evident stagnation, as there is no predicted year-on-year percentage variation or overall CAGR reflecting growth over the 5-year period.
